Susanah Hollingsworth was born in 1758 in Rockland, New Castle County, Delaware, United States of America, the child of Thomas Hollingsworth And Jane Smith. Susanah Hollingsworth married Robert Burnett Sr, and had children including Amor Burnett, Freeman Burnett, Henry Burnett, Jane Burnett, John S Burnet, John S Burnett, Mary Polly Burnett, Mary Friend, Robert Burnett, Samuel Burnett, Susan Burnett, Susannah Burnett, Thomas Burnett. Susanah Hollingsworth passed away in 1824 in Fayette County, Ohio, United States of America.
